Sat 1264692994330905

decimal
295877.494330905
degree
0°85877′1541″494330905‴
percentile
60.22347598676514%
name
ewuyuxitxpg
cycle
0
epoch
1
period
146
block
295877
offset
494330905
timestamp
rarity
common